WebShould the government engage in public shaming? This Article aims to evaluate administrative agencies’ practice of shaming corporations into good behavior. Regulatory shaming is now at a crossroads. While some agencies are currently adopting new shaming strategies, others are rolling back such practices. It could cause depression, suicidal thoughts and other severe mental problems. The humiliated individuals may develop a variety of symptoms including apathy, paranoia, anxiety, PTSD, or others.
